I have been using IE 6.0 for some time without problem,
but suddenly it has stoppped working. I get an error
message that it has "experienced a problem and needs to
close" and gives the option of sending an error message to
Microsoft. I have tried repairing and then removing the
program through the "Add/Delete Software" option on the
Control Panel, and then reloading the software, but to no
avail. I have no problem logging on to my ISP and using
other Internet software (like Quicken.com), but I can't
log on to the Internet via IE at all on my desktop
computer.

Any suggestions? Thanks
 
When you click the Internet Explorer icon, window may flash a second and quits. Or, it may show an Error-Reporting dialog. This may be due to a malware Browser Helper Object which causes Internet Explorer process to terminate. If you see the Error-Reporting dialog, click "to see what data this report contains" and identify the Module Name causing this error. In most cases, it may be the spyware DLL. Therefore, reinstalling Internet Explorer [in case of a spyware DLL] may not help.

To test with: Disable third-party browser extensions in Internet Explorer:

1. Click Start, point to Settings, and then click Control Panel.
2. Double-click Internet Options.
3. Click the Advanced tab.
4. Under Browsing, clear the Enable third-party browser extensions
(requires restart) check box.
5. Restart Internet Explorer.
